The Wilesco steam roller Old Smoky D375 as a kit
This D375 kit has the same features as the pre-assembled steam roller. With this kit, you'll experience firsthand how steam engines are constructed and work step by step on combining all the individual parts. The kit is easy to assemble even for inexperienced steam engine enthusiasts, thanks to the detailed, richly illustrated assembly instructions. The approximate time required to assemble the steam roller is three to four hours. It's best if assembly can be carried out without interruption. All individual parts of the steam tractor were subjected to careful quality control before leaving our steam engine factory.

We have been producing the Old Smoky steam roller in this form since the mid-1960s; it was the first mobile model steam engine in the Wilesco range.
This model of a mobile steam engine was modeled after a widely used steam roller that was used in road construction until the 1950s.
The color scheme hasn't changed since the 60s!
Mobile and stationary steam roller
A catwalk, chain steering, and gear coupling are standard features of our Old Smoky. The coupling—operated by a rod to the left of the driver's cab—allows the steam roller to also be operated as a stationary steam engine. With its 230 cc boiler, the Old Smoky is powerful enough to pull accessories in mobile operation as well as drive models in stationary operation. The aluminum roller wheels of this steam roller are anodized and painted.
For indoor and outdoor use
Our Wilesco D365 steam roller is suitable for both outdoor and indoor use. Since the Wilesco D375 has a bidirectional flywheel, it can drive forward and backward, and is steered by a timing chain. During operation, the steam roller's chimney emits authentic smoke. Running time with one load of original Witabs solid fuel is approximately 15 minutes. Running time may be slightly shorter when using other solid fuel brands.
